Baal Shem Tov, founder of the Hasidic movement, tells a story: 

A deaf man walks by a window with people dancing inside. 

He can only see them gyrating peculiarly, making weird motions.

  He thinks they are insane.  That’s because he doesn’t hear the music.

  If you’re deaf to the melody, the motions of prayer seem absurd.

  If you believe that conversation between man and G-d is possible,

prayer not only makes sense, it lets you dance to celestial music
